We discovered this hotel and its location completely by chance — and it turned out to be an absolute gem. The entire setting is beautifully designed, with attention paid to every detail. Although the hotel is quite spacious, the way it’s laid out gives it a cozy, almost boutique feel.
The wellness area is truly exceptional. We especially appreciated the textile-free zone and were pleasantly surprised by how respectfully other guests behaved — it created a calm and relaxing atmosphere.
The food was excellent, the staff were friendly and professional, and the facilities cater equally well to those seeking an active holiday or pure relaxation. We loved that you can borrow bikes, trekking poles, and backpacks — we took advantage of the bike rental and everything was in perfect condition and super easy to arrange.
All in all, this is genuinely one of the best hotels we’ve ever stayed at — and we travel a lot. Highly recommended!

The accommodation exceeded our expectations. The owners were very kind, welcoming, and paid attention to every detail. Everything was beautifully designed, modern, and spotlessly clean. The apartments were well-equipped and of high quality.
A big plus was the elevator, providing easy access to the upper floors, making the place fully accessible. The common room was spacious and comfortable, perfect for relaxing in the evening.
I only have two small remarks: the breakfast was quite overpriced, and the bathroom door was partially see-through, which was a bit unusual 😄.
Despite these minor things, I would definitely stay here again and highly recommend this place to everyone. A fantastic experience!

The hotel is great. Location is superb, quiet, out of the village and prime access to great hiking, not far from the lake. The room is phenomenal. Great size, great interior, warm, comfortable and stunning views. Staff are super friendly and the food is great, if not quite as good as in other hotels in the area. The spa offers good facilities for hotel guests only, so the size works. The steam room is about the only thing that is below par, it is small with awkward and uncomfortable seats. Overall the value for the prize is very good indeed.

On average, 3-star hotels in Achenkirch cost € 91.95 per night, and 4-star hotels in Achenkirch are € 352.08 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Achenkirch can on average be found for € 459.46 per night (based on Booking.com prices).
On average, it costs € 156 per night to book a 3-star hotel in Achenkirch for tonight. You'll pay on average around € 422.22 if you choose to stay in a 4-star hotel tonight, while a 5-star hotel in Achenkirch will cost around € 465 (based on Booking.com prices).
